If you want a hingeless album, your options will be expensive. Albums can generally be divided into two groups -- affordable and, let's say, much less affordable. In the latter (expensive) group are Lighthouse, Schaubek, etc. Buying a hingeless Poland album from them will run over $1000, probably a good deal more. The more affordable albums include, mainly, Scott and Davo with Scott being less expensive but also not offering hingeless pages.
I like Scott albums a lot. They have a very classic look and they are affordable. Their pages have a nice fancy border and the pages are cream colored. Binders can be either 2-post or 3-ring using the same pages. Pages and binders for an entire country generally won't cost more than a few (?) hundred dollars, perhaps $400, rarely $500 for big stamp-issuing countries, much less for the less profligate. Slipcases are available at extra cost. Pages will not have mounts, but it's not hard to add mounts one by one as you go.
Davo albums are a bit different in page size, layout, and so on. Pages are bright white. Binders are padded while Scott's are not, and they are only available in 2-post format. Dust cases are also available for Davo albums, and in fact they are included in the somewhat higher price compared to Scott. Davo binders come with pages and dustcase as a set (unlike Scott where you can purchase pages without binders).
Davo album (pages, binder, slipcase together) are more expensive than Scott albums. Entire countries will run about twice the price of Scott, typically $500-1000 for the three or four (or five) volumes you'll need, depending on whether you choose the more expensive hingeless pages or not. Davo albums, unlike Scott, can be purchased either with -- or without -- mounts, the latter being less expensive, of course. You can buy one set of pages (Scott) or one album (Davo) at a time. No need to buy them all at once.
So your choice is to go very expensive and buy Lighthouse, etc. or less expensive. Among the lower-priced albums, either save some money and add mounts one by one to a Scott album, buy the less expensive Davo pages and add mounts to them, or buy the Davo hingeless pages. Any of these choices will give you a first-rate, attractive album. I have many Scott albums and many Davo albums, as well, and I like them both.
